Meaning: Good deeds

Jaskaran is a Sikh name that means "good deeds. " It is associated with the lucky number 3 and is believed to bring joy and stability. The name has its roots indian culture and is often given to boys to signify their potential for doing good and being honest. Over time, the use of the name Jaskaran has remained consistent in its cultural significance, but its popularity can vary depending on regional preferences. The name is important because it reflects the values of honesty and fairness, which are highly regarded in Sikh tradition.
